Job Description

The DO is not just a job, it is a purpose. 

The Diversity Org is a global nonprofit that teaches low-income and minority students about how to obtain corporate and high-income careers. We partner with large companies where students learn about careers they may not have known existed, participate in professional development workshops with corporate employees, and also obtain access to internships/entry-level positions.

The companies we are currently in partnership with are J.P. Morgan Chase, Blackstone, AT&T, Kellogg's, Warner Bros. Discovery (CNN, HBO, Cartoon Network, DC Comics), Verizon, Yahoo, Salesforce, Ernst & Young, Informa, Paramount (MTV, VH1, Nickelodeon) Versace and more!
